Thus concatenating them adds nothing but some complexity while reading the code. - - - - - 2f01ff74 by Richard Eisenberg at 2025-10-21T16:26:49+01:00 Refactor fundep solving This commit is a large-scale refactor of the increasingly-messy code that handles functional dependencies. It has virtually no effect on what compiles but improves error messages a bit. And it does the groundwork for #23162. The big picture is described in Note [Overview of functional dependencies in type inference] in GHC.Tc.Solver.FunDeps * New module GHC.Tc.Solver.FunDeps contains all the fundep-handling code for the constraint solver. * Fundep-equalities are solved in a nested scope; they may generate unifications but otherwise have no other effect. See GHC.Tc.Solver.FunDeps.solveFunDeps The nested needs to start from the Givens in the inert set, but not the Wanteds; hence a new function `resetInertCans`, used in `nestFunDepsTcS`. * That in turn means that fundep equalities never show up in error messages, so the complicated FunDepOrigin tracking can all disappear. * We need to be careful about tracking unifications, so we kick out constraints from the inert set after doing unifications. Unification tracking has been majorly reformed: see Note [WhatUnifications] in GHC.Tc.Utils.Unify. A good consequence is that the hard-to-grok `resetUnificationFlag` has been replaced with a simpler use of `reportCoarseGrainUnifications` Smaller things: * Rename `FunDepEqn` to `FunDepEqns` since it contains multiple type equalities. Some compile time improvement Metrics: compile_time/bytes allocated Baseline Test value New value Change ---------------------- -------------------------------------- T5030(normal) 173,839,232 148,115,248 -14.8% GOOD hard_hole_fits(normal) 286,768,048 284,015,416 -1.0% geo. mean -0.2% minimum -14.8% maximum +0.3% Metric Decrease: T5030 - - - - - 804f7661 by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:26:50+01:00 QuickLook's tcInstFun should make instantiation variables directly tcInstFun must make "instantiation variables", not regular unification variables, when instantiating function types. That was previously implemented by a hack: set the /ambient/ level to QLInstTyVar. But the hack finally bit me, when I was refactoring WhatUnifications. And it was always wrong: see the now-expunged (TCAPP2) note. This commit does it right, by making tcInstFun call its own instantiation functions. That entails a small bit of duplication, but the result is much, much cleaner. - - - - - 71d63e6e by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:26:50+01:00 Build implication for constraints from (static e) This commit addresses #26466, by buiding an implication for the constraints arising from a (static e) form. The implication has a special ic_info field of StaticFormSkol, which tells the constraint solver to use an empty set of Givens. See (SF3) in Note [Grand plan for static forms] in GHC.Iface.Tidy.StaticPtrTable This commit also reinstates an `assert` in GHC.Tc.Solver.Equality. The rewriter returns the RewriterSet! - - - - - a56335d1 by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:26:50+01:00 Tidy up trySolveImplication This completes some leftover mess from commit 14123ee646f2b9738a917b7cec30f9d3941c13de Author: Simon Peyton Jones <simon.peytonjones@gmail.com> Date: Wed Aug 20 00:35:48 2025 +0100 Solve forall-constraints via an implication, again - - - - - 9b93d4cd by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:26:50+01:00 Big increment in rewriter tracking Needs more documentation More tidying up of rewriter sets - - - - - 85938f59 by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:29:46+01:00 Do not treat CoercionHoles as free variables in coercions This fixes a long-standing wart in the free-variable finder; now CoercionHoles are no longer treated as a "free variable" of a coercion. I got big and unexpected performance regressions when making this change. Turned out that CallArity didn't discover that the free variable finder could be eta-expanded, which gave very poor code. So I re-used Note [The one-shot state monad trick] for Endo, resulting in GHC.Utils.EndoOS. Very simple, big win. - - - - - 848dc054 by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:29:46+01:00 Fix buglet in solving equalities from QCIs - - - - - 5ae3c227 by Simon Peyton Jones at 2025-10-21T16:29:46+01:00 Improve equality checking for foralls a bit ...by re-using the TcEvBindsVar -
